In a landmark achievement for Macau's cardiac surgery landscape, the cardiac team at Kiang Wu Hospital successfully performed their first procedure using the innovative smartcanula® on November 24, 2025.

The complex case involved a double heart valve repair (mitral and tricuspid) via a minimally invasive approach. The surgery was supported by the expertise of Dr. Daniel Chan from Hong Kong's Queen Mary Hospital, facilitating a seamless introduction of the technology.


The surgical and perfusion teams reported outstanding results. They highlighted the smartcanula®'s impressive ease of use and its ability to provide efficient, powerful venous drainage without requiring vacuum assistance or caval snaring. This capability allowed the heart to be rapidly emptied, creating an optimally clear and bloodless surgical field that significantly streamlined the complex procedure.

This successful first case marks a critical milestone in advancing minimally invasive cardiac surgery (MICS) capabilities in Macau. The smartcanula®'s performance demonstrates its potential to simplify surgical workflows and enhance precision for complex interventions.
